Big Red Dragon: Play Rhymes Through the Year
Publisher: Otter-Barry Books
This collection of original rhymes is a useful tool for anyone wanting to make storytime more interactive and fun.
There are 15 rhymes on different subjects – for instance, dinosaurs, pets, vehicles – and some seasonal events, such as Easter, Halloween, Diwali and Christmas.
On the same page as each short rhyme are suggestions for actions to perform at the same time. These actions are very simple, such as stretching your arms above your head or cupping your hands to indicate something is in them. Any children listening can easily do the same actions – in fact, they should be encouraged to do so! Particularly the stomping like a dinosaur, which is always very popular.
The soft illustrations beautifully complement the gentle actions and rhymes. (The stomping is as raucous as it gets!) This would be lovely to share with a baby, as well as a toddler or older child, as the repetition and the rhyme encourage language acquisition.
Adding actions to this makes the whole experience more memorable and enjoyable, for the child, but also the adult. This book makes storytime easy!
